Pavement - Quarantine The Past

Quarantine The Past: The Best Of Pavement has just been released.

According to Matador Records:

This fully remastered 23-track compilation will be available on MID-PRICED double LP, CD and digital album formats. The tracks span the entirety of Pavement’s career from 1989 to 1999, from the scratchy and mysterious sounds of their early vinyl-only releases to the rich, multilayered warmth of their final recordings. Although the compilation does not include any unreleased material, it definitely digs deeper than the hits.

It precedes their first live dates since 1999, including dates in the UK in London and Glasgow and at All Tomorrow's Parties and ends with 4 dates in Central Park, New York in September 2010.

Last night saw the launch of the UK Americana compilation Divided By A Common Language at the Lexington in London. Bands on the night included The Snakes, Alan Tyler, Two Fingers Of Firewater and The Hi and Lo. Other bands on the album include The Redlands Palamino Company, The Barker Band and the Cedars.
